In this webinar, assessment and intervention experts, Erin Barton, PhD and Elizabeth Steed, PhD, describe the purpose of social-emotional screening of young children in the context of promoting social-emotional development and identifying children at risk for social-emotional difficulties. This webinar provides an overview of specific social-emotional screening tools and how one might pick a tool for their program\u2019s use. The presenters use a case study to illustrate how to implement one of the most widely used tools, ASQ:SE-2, and make decisions about next steps for children at risk for social-emotional challenges. Learning objectives:<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n
\n
Describe the purpose of social-emotional screening.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
Name several social-emotional screening tools.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
Explain how a social emotional screening tool is administered in collaboration with families.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
Describe how to use screening results to plan next steps based on children\u2019s scores.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n
